This course is ideal for students, who have basic knowledge of reading Western Classical Music (Piano). The student showing and interest to use basic elements of music (melody and rhythm) with harmony to improvise musical phrases. The course will give insight into Reading, Understanding and Playing Trinity Initial Grade Exam Pieces and Exercises. Students shall also learn how to read and play perfectly with the Metronome as well as develops listening, reading & playing skills with an exploratory outlook in additionl to acquiring knowledge. This course shall make students eligible to appear for Trinity College of London (TCL) Exams Grade 1(Piano) &/or Grade 1(Theory). Study material used for the course reference is TCL exam books only. Additionally, Western Classical Music shall be included as an external repetoir for the student to perform as Pianist. THREE Trinity Pieces are learnt and THREE Exercises are leant in the course along with Technical Skills (Scales & Broken Chords). The student learns composing a tune on Grand Staff on through the process of learning dynamics & articulations giving them a joy of music creation.

Objectives

- To build awareness of different genres of music

- To learn to play Accidentals (Sharps, Flats and Natural)

- To be introduce Major Scales & Relative minors (G Major, F Major with relative minors)

- To understand, identify & play Dynamics (mp- mezzo piano & mf- mezzo forte);

- To understand, identify & play Articulations (Accent mark, Crescendo, Diminuendo, Fermata)

- To learn & play basic sheet music
